Transaction 60e129807829ec94ef1c9719da773be0cf8c21e668cd4c50d2c0f8dd850f6c36
1 Input
1 Output
-
60e129807829ec94ef1c9719da773be0cf8c21e668cd4c50d2c0f8dd850f6c36:0
- value
- 110107
- script pubkey
- OP_0 OP_PUSHBYTES_20 81e9c15cae276bc75aa14de25d1b2a376200529a
- address
- bc1qs85uzh9wya4uwk4pfh396xe2xa3qq5566yyxgk